Asus ROG Phone 9 FE features

According to a recent report, the Asus ROG Phone 9 FE boasts a sleek design, closely resembling the ROG Phone 9 Pro. 

The ROG Phone 9 FE features a 6.78-inch 1080p LTPO AMOLED display with a 165Hz refresh rate, which can boost up to 185Hz for a more immersive gaming experience. 

The device measures 8.9mm thick, weighs 225 grams, and features AirTrigger controls, a signature component of Asus's gaming devices. 

Powered by the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 chipset, the Asus ROG Phone 9 FE is paired with 16 GB of RAM and 256 GB of UFS 4.0 storage and runs on Android 15. 

The ROG Phone 9 FE also packs a 5,500mAh battery with 65W wired and wireless charging. 

Under the camera belt, the ROG Phone 9 FE features a 50MP primary camera, a 13MP ultrawide lens, and a 5MP macro camera. 

The device also sports a 32MP front-facing camera. It will be available in Phantom Black colour, maintaining the bold and gaming-oriented aesthetic that the ROG series is known for. 

Asus ROG Phone 9 FE price

Although official pricing details are not available, the Asus ROG Phone 9 FE is expected to be priced below $800-700. It is worth noting that the standard ROG Phone 9 was priced at $899.
